The Root Collective partners with small-scale artisan businesses in Guatemala to craft handmade shoes that people actually want to wear. We’re dedicated to promoting economic independence and believe that a hand up and not a hand out is the most effective way to tackle poverty around the world. The fabric on our shoes is handwoven by a 100% women and worker owned cooperatives in the highlands of Guatemala. The shoes are crafted in the slum of La Limonada in Guatemala City by former gang members who have been given a second chance at life through making shoes.
